What is Pharma Aids FCF Margin %?

Pharma Aids DHA:PHARMAID -2.55% 73 FCF Margin % is 6.91% as of Mar. 2026, which is 7% above its 10-year median of 6.46. GuruFocus rates DHA:PHARMAID with a GF Score™ of 73/100 and a GF Value™ of BDT758.56 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 3 warning signs investors should review. Among 817 Medical Devices & Instruments companies, Pharma Aids ranks better than 54.1% on this metric.

FCF Margin % is calculated as Free Cash Flow divided by its Revenue. Pharma Aids's Free Cash Flow for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was BDT8.5 Mil. Pharma Aids's Revenue for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was BDT123.3 Mil. Therefore, Pharma Aids's FCF Margin %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 6.91%.

As of today, Pharma Aids's current FCF Yield % is 0.31%.

Pharma Aids FCF Margin % Calculation

FCF margin is the ratio of Free Cash Flow div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Pharma Aids's FCF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(A: Jun.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Jun. 2025 )
=-30.905/438.088
=-7.05 %

Pharma Aids's FCF Margin for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

FCF Margin=Free Cash Flow (Q: Mar. 2026 )/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=8.515/123.25
=6.91 %

Pharma Aids Business Description

Address 345 Segun Bagicha, 1st Floor, Ramna, Dhaka, BGD, 1000
Pharma Aids Ltd is a Bangladesh-based company engaged in the manufacturing of neutral glass ampoules, USP Type-I. Ampoules are used by pharmaceutical companies for filling liquid injections. The company produces different sizes of ampoules from 1ml to 25ml, in Clear and Amber color, and in Amber color, and of both Open Mouth (Form B and C) and Close Mouth (Form D, Din and Marzocchi type).
